  • UGANDA CUP 2014/15: KCC, SC Villa To Play Final

    2014/15 UGANDA CUP SEMI-FINALS (Return Leg):

    Sunday, 3rd May 2015 Fixtures:

    Semi-final results (return leg)
    SC Villa 1-0 Bul – Nakivubo stadium
    [Aggregate Score: SC Villa 2-0 Bul]
    Lweza 0-1 KCC – Mutesa II Stadium, Wankulukuku
    [Aggregate Score: KCC 2-0 KCC]
    It is confirmed Kampala City Council (KCC) and Sports Club Villa will face each other in this year’s Uganda Cup final on 30th May, 2015 but the FUFA Executive will confirm the venue soon.
    Western Region of Kitara region placed in their bids to host the final.
    The final was decided following the return leg of two fixtures of the 41st Uganda Cup.
    Prior to the return legs, SC Villa and KCC both carried a 1-0 goal lead from their respective first legs.
    Augustine Nsumba scored for SC Villa at Nakivubo to double the advantage after they had won the first leg in Jinja – thanks to Denis Kamanzi’s goal whilst Herman Wasswa scored for KCC home and away against Lweza.
    The KCC – SC Villa match in the Uganda Cup will be a repeat of the 1990 final that saw the ‘Kasairo boys’ edge SC Villa 2-1 and also deny them a League and cup double.
    URA, the defending champions were eliminated out of the cup at the round of 16 stage by KCC after a 1-2 result in Lugazi.
    The eventual winner of the Uganda Cup will represent the country at the CAF Confederation cup.

  • AZAM UGANDA PREMIER LEAGUE: Vipers, SC Villa Win to Keep on Course For Title

    Azam Uganda Premier League: 1st May 2015 Results:

    SC Villa 3-1 Entebbe

    Vipers 1-0 Police F.C

    Bright Stars 1-1 Lweza

    Sports Club Victoria University 2-0 Simba

    Vipers and Sports Club Villa won their respective Azam Uganda Premier league fixtures on Friday, 1st May 2015.

    The two clubs, vying for the 2014/15 championship are neck to neck with less than six fixtures to the end of the season.

    SC Villa won their encounter against Entebbe. Farouk Katongole put the ball into his own net after Isaac Muleme’s cross from the left.

    Erisa Ssekisambuu doubled the lead in the first half before Denis Kamanzi found the third.

    At Buikwe, Vipers also won 1-0 against visiting Police F.C.

    Midfielder, Farouk Miya scored the only goal on the day for the Vipers who have now collected 59 points, two ahead of second placed SC Villa.

    Vipers has now played 26 games and SC Villa has 25 games.

    At Matugga, Bright Stars and Lweza played to a 1 all draw.

    Geofrey Sserunkuma put the visitors ahead with Hassan Kikoyo’s penalty making amends in the 79th minute after defender, Julius Mutyaba had handled the ball in the forbidden area.

    The league will resume on Tuesday, 5th May 2015.

  • ADMINISTRATION: Club Management Course Concludes at the FUFA Technical Center

    ADMINISTRATION: Club Management Course Concludes at the FUFA Technical Center

    A five-day FUFA Club Administration and Management course successfully ended on Frinday (1st May 2015) at the FUFA Technical Centre in Njeru.

    Twenty four participants from Uganda premier league and FUFA Big league clubs were taking part in the course presented by six instructors.

    FUFA president Eng. Moses Magogo (FIFA Instructor), Sam Mpiima (Caf Instructor), Edgar Watson (FUFA CEO), Decolas Kizza (FUFA Finance Director), Ahmed Hussein (Fufa Spokesperson) and FUFA Lawyer Alex Luganda  all instructed.

    Speaking at the closing ceremony, Federation head Eng. Moses Magogo said FUFA is trying to develop its own channels through which professionalism can be realized in our game of football in Uganda.

    As FUFA we decided to bring this course at a free cost to all secretaries of Super and Big league clubs but some have come and some have deliberately refused to come. None of you participants were evaluated on their potential to become participants in this course. Being attached to a club was the only passport we wanted.
    So I repeat this again, no club in our top tier or Big league setup will be allowed to play in the league with effect from next season 2015/6 if they don’t have qualified Chief Executive Officers.

    He stressed.

    fufa__president_jinja_mayor
    FUFA President, Eng. Moses Magogo hands a Uganda Cranes jersery to Hajji Kirunda Mubarak the Jinja Central Division LC III chairperson

    Hajji Kirunda Mubarak the Jinja Central Division LC III chairperson who officially closed the course, said administration and management in every aspect of life are very important components to determine the progress of success or the lack thereof.

    Sports as an industry is supposed to be run on efficient and effective administration but also with discipline. One cannot expect success if the administration, management and leadership are found wanting.
    He added that the problems with sports clubs are not because of the players but because of the leadership that is not functioning well which, therefore, leads the teams in the wrong direction.

    Therefore, he urged the participants to prove that this course was not just a waste of time and urged them to execute.

    participants
    Participants attending the theory sessions during one of the theory classes

     

    The course covered topics such as FUFA Structures, FUFA Development, Finance, Club Management, Planning, Competitions, Marketing, Events Management and Communication.

  • AIPS President Gianni Merlo to visit FUFA

    The Federation of Uganda Football Associations (FUFA)is in receipt of communication from Uganda Sports Press Association(USPA) regarding the visit of AIPS President Gianni Merlo.

    The notification for the visit of  Merlo to the headquarters of FUFA in Mengo was received last week.

    giannimerlo
    AIPS President Gianni Merlo will visit the headquarters of Ugandan football in Mengo on Thursday.

     

    ‘We are looking forward to receiving a powerful figure in the global sports media. FUFA will use this opportunity to share ideas with the AIPS President on pertinent issues in regard to sports media reporting on football activities’ said FUFA Spokesperson Ahmed Hussein.

    FUFA has already held talks with the top officials of USPA-President Sabiiti Muwanga and Vice President Aliguma Ritah and agreed on the programme.

    The visit is slated for Thursday 30th April,2015 at 3pm at FUFA House where the AIPS boss will hold talks with FUFA President Eng.Moses Magogo and FUFA CEO Edgar Watson.

    About the AIPS President Gianni Merlo

    • Has been AIPS President since 2005 when he was elected to the post.
    • He is also a renowned Sports journalist who still corresponds for Italy’s leading sports daily Gazzetta dello Sport
    • Has covered 20 Summer and Winter Olympic Games and over 30 European and World Championships in Athletics in his illustrious journalism career which stretches back to 1967.
    • Prior to ascending to the Association’s Presidency Gianni served as the president of the AIPS European section,UEPS, from 1984 to 1988.
    • He also served as Chairman of the Athletics commission since 1986 and also led the IAAF press commission since 2004.
    • Gianni is also a member of the IOC press commission.

  • FUFA BIG LEAGUE: Emunyu brings down The Saints

    Soroti Garage 2-1 The Saints

    The race for qualification to the Azam Uganda Premier League in the Rwenzori group is getting tighter each passing day as the season gets to a grand finale.

    With two rounds of play left for the top two teams-Jinja Municipal FC and The Saints  FC,only one point separates the duo after yesterday’s solitary game in the North East when Soroti Garage edged The saints 2-1.

    Paul Emunyu kicked off the party for the home side with a 2nd minute goal before completing his double in the 62th minute.

    Bukenya Kitata scored the solitary The Saints’ solitary strike in the 70th minute.

    JMC FC is still on top with 52 points while The saints are on 51 but both teams will face off on 7th May, 2015 at Namboole Stadium.

    Before that titanic fixture that could decide the winner of the Rwenzori Group, The Saints will host Namasagali at Namboole stadium while JMC travel to West Nile to face Paidha Black Angels, all games are slated for 31st April, 2015.

    The Elgon group has Maroons on top with 34 points while Kirinya Jinja SS is second with 33 points. Both teams have two rounds of play left.

  • EDUCATION: FUFA Club Management Course Starts Monday

    FUFA Club Management Course:

    Monday, 27th April – 1st May 2015

    At FUFA Technical Center, Njeru

    The Federation of Uganda Football Associations (FUFA) club management course gets underway on Monday, 27th April 2015 at the FUFA Technical center in Njeru.

    Twenty five people will attend the week long course whose intention is in line and the agenda to professionalize the elite club football, for the management of club football in Uganda.

    The intention is to ensure that qualified personnel are prepared for the management of football at club level.

    There will be examinations at the end of this course. The minimum requirement for this course is the Uganda Advanced Certificate of Education for those with 5 years’ experience in football administration or a Bachelor’s Degree.

    For the club to obtain a license to play in the 1st and 2nd Division leagues (i.e Elite League and Big league) for the 2015/16 season, there is a requirement that the Club CEO must be a holder of this certificate.

    This year alone, FUFA has organized several workshops and football courses for administrators targeted to uplift the standard of the game in the country
